not get (one's) knickers in a twist
To avoid becoming overly upset or emotional over something, especially that which is trivial or unimportant. Typically used as an imperative. Ah, don't get your knickers in a twist—I'll have the car back by tomorrow morning! In my opinion, people shouldn't get their knickers in a twist about every little thing they see online. Come on, life's too short!
